H.R. 7909
To am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 to provide for an exclusion from gross income for compensation of certain school resource officers, and for other purposes.

What it doesSummary introduced in house (May 27, 2022)
This bill excludes from gross income, for income tax purposes, compensation paid to a qualified school resource officer. The bill defines qualified school resource officer as a retired law enforcement officer who is employed as an armed school resource officer at an elementary or secondary school. The bill also exempts such compensation from employment taxation and withholding requirements.
